With the Powerwinch 915 trailer winch, on the other hand, loading your boat is as easy as pressing a button and relaxing in a lawn chair. The 915 features a smooth power-in/freewheel out action, having the ability to pull a boat as heavy as 9,500 pounds. The 915 also offers a vertical lift capacity of 3,200 pounds, with an option for doubling the pull/line capacity with the usage of a pulley block (included) at the bow eye. This doubles your cable and halves the retrieval speed, giving you more strength (5,900 pounds) out of your trailer winch. In spite of everything, the 915 offers the option of a full power-out function, letting you keep watch over your boat as it’s lowered into the water quite than letting gravity care for the task. Other features include a line speed of 10 feet per minute, an emergency hand crank, a 60 amp standard wiring harness. The Powerwinch 912 carries a one-year warranty.
Specifications
- Max boat weight: 9,500 pounds
- Vertical lift capacity: 3,200 pounds (single line)
- Line speed: 10 fpm
- Remote keep watch over: No
- Light: No
- Double line capacity: 5,900 pounds
- Gear ratio: 450:1
- Power source: 12 volts
- Circuit breaker: 60 amp
- Cable length: 40 feet
- Cable diameter: 7/32 inches
- Winch dimensions: 10 by 8 by 10 inches (W x H x D)
- Weight: 40 pounds
